Post by Admin on Aug 7, 2006 22:03:03 GMT -5
FilePlanet has a beta. you must be a subscriber. The beta will have the whole sim as it existed when the beta disks were burned.
Gamespot will have the official DEMO, not the same thing as the beta. The demo will have limited things to try, not the whole sim. It should be a free download.
